Story summary
- A groundbreaking study from Denmark uncovers that more than 54% of people who suffer a transient ischemic attack (TIA) endure lingering fatigue for up to a year. Analyzing 354 participants, researchers suggest this fatigue arises from the brain's struggle to recover. This highlights a critical need for improved support systems to help patients manage their fatigue effectively.
